Data-driven decisions

from class:

Human-Computer Interaction

Definition

Data-driven decisions refer to the process of making choices and setting strategies based on analyzed data rather than intuition or personal experience. This approach emphasizes the importance of using empirical evidence to inform actions, allowing for more effective and precise outcomes, especially in educational technology and learning interfaces where understanding user behavior and learning patterns is crucial for optimizing educational tools.

5 Must Know Facts For Your Next Test

  1. Data-driven decisions enhance the ability to evaluate the effectiveness of educational tools by analyzing student engagement and learning outcomes.
  2. The integration of data analytics in educational technology helps identify areas where learners struggle, allowing for targeted interventions.
  3. Using data-driven approaches can lead to personalized learning experiences, where educational interfaces adapt to the individual needs of students.
  4. Data-driven decisions are essential for educators and developers to make informed choices about content delivery methods and platform functionalities.
  5. This decision-making process can help improve overall educational outcomes by continuously refining teaching strategies based on real-time data.

Review Questions

  • How can data-driven decisions improve the effectiveness of educational technology?
    • Data-driven decisions can significantly enhance the effectiveness of educational technology by allowing educators to assess which tools and methods are most successful in engaging students. By analyzing data related to user interactions, completion rates, and assessment results, educators can identify successful strategies and areas needing improvement. This targeted approach ensures that learning tools evolve based on actual performance metrics rather than assumptions.
  • Discuss the impact of learning analytics on creating personalized learning experiences through data-driven decisions.
    • Learning analytics plays a critical role in facilitating personalized learning experiences by leveraging data-driven decisions. By collecting and analyzing data on individual learner behaviors, preferences, and performance, educators can tailor content and instructional approaches to meet specific needs. This customization not only enhances engagement but also improves retention rates as learners receive support that aligns with their unique learning styles.
  • Evaluate the long-term implications of relying on data-driven decisions in the development of educational interfaces.
    • Relying on data-driven decisions in developing educational interfaces has significant long-term implications for both educators and learners. As these interfaces evolve based on continuous data analysis, they become more intuitive and aligned with users' needs, potentially increasing user satisfaction and success rates. Additionally, this reliance fosters a culture of accountability and continuous improvement among educators and developers. However, it also raises concerns about privacy and the ethical use of learner data, which must be addressed to maintain trust in educational technologies.
